Youth, College and Amateur
Maganto spent five seasons in the Getafe youth system. Maganto was offered a contract to play for Getafe"s B team but instead elected to move to the United States to play football on a scholarship at Iona College. In his four seasons with the Gaels, he made a total of 71 appearances and tallied 27 goals and 14 assists.
He also played in the Premier Development League with Reading United, making a total of 9 appearances and tallied 2 goals.
Professional
= Los Angeles Galaxy On January 15, 2015, Maganto was selected 21st overall in the 2015 Master of Library Science SuperDraft by the Los Angeles Galaxy. He signed a professional contract with the club two months later.
On March 22, Maganto made his professional debut with USL affiliate club Los Angeles Galaxy II in a 0–0 draw against Real Monarchs Salt Lake City. On 19 April, Maganto made another appearance with Los Angeles Galaxy II against Austin Aztex Football Club which ended in a 2–1 victory for the Galaxy"son On 2 May 2015, Maganto made his debut for the first team, starting on the left side of midfield, against Colorado Rapids.
Maganto ended his debut early when he was substituted off in the 72nd minute for goal scorer Alan Gordon as the Galaxy"s end the game with in a 1–1 draw.
Maganto scored an one-touch goal, his first for the Galaxy"s, in an away game against New England Revolution which ended in a 2–2 draw on May 31. He was waived by Los Angeles Galaxy on February 29, 2016.
